#01dd3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01dd3c is composed of 0.4% red, 86.7%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 136.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.5%. #01dd3c color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ff78 with #00bb00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#01dd3c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000602 is the darkest color, while #f2fff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#01dd3c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67776c is the less saturated color, while #01dd3c is the most saturated one.
